AI Summary
-
Creates three new crimes of assault against mass transit employees (public bus and light rail workers) while performing their duties
-
First-degree assault: attempting to kill or knowingly causing serious physical injury, classified as a class B felony
-
Second-degree assault: includes seven scenarios ranging from causing physical injury with deadly weapons to criminal negligence creating substantial risk of death, classified as class C felony (or class B felony for certain subdivisions)
-
Third-degree assault: includes recklessly causing physical injury, purposely placing employee in apprehension of immediate physical injury, or knowingly causing unwanted physical contact, classified as a class B misdemeanor
-
Applies to employees of public bus and light rail companies acting within the scope of their duties
Legislative Description
Creates the crimes of assault of an employee of a mass transit system while in the scope of his or her duties in the first, second, and third degree
